Most of my career was making jet engine, rocket engine, wings, and medical devices. We had our own coating shop because all of the outside ones went out of business or were bought by the prime contractors. Every blade root or vane foot was coated with exotic no stick coatings, tips were coated with cbn, and the material combinations later on used electron beam or plasma to deposit high temp coatings. crazy world.
